Frankie Edgar will take on B.J. Penn in the Lightweight Championship fight, in which will be part of UFC 118. This fight, and the entire event will be held at the TD Garden in Boston, MA. The date of the event is Saturday August 28th, 2010.

Frankie Edgar is a former high school and college wrestler. Known as “The Answer” is from Toms River, New Jersey; and stands 5’6 and weighs 155lbs. He currently fights for Renzo Gracie Combat Team, and uses the wrestling and boxing style, along with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u. As a mixed martial arts fighter, Edgar has won 12 of 13 bouts, with his lone loss coming to Gray Maynard in April of 2008. Edgar’s most recent fight was a win over Penn, which won him the UFC Lightweight Championship.
B.J. Penn has been training in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u since was 17 years old. “The Prodigy” was born and raised in Hawaii, and still resides there. Penn stands at 5’9, and weighs 155lbs, and holds a 15-6 record. A few of Penn’s most notable wins have come over Kenny Florian and Diego Sanchez. Two of his losses came to Georges St. Pierre and Frankie Edgar. Penn started his UFC career back in March of 2006, when St. Pierre beat him in a split decision.
